Nine DHS Employees Receive the 2015 Presidential Rank Award
12-15-2015 02:00 PM Release Date: December 15, 2015 For Immediate Release DHS Press Office Contact: 202-282-8010 WASHINGTON – Today, the White House Office of Management and Budget and the U.S. Office of Personnel Management announced the 2015 Presidential Rank Award recipients, recognizing and celebrating some of the federal government’s top career executives and senior professionals for consistently demonstrating strength, integrity, and commitment to public service. The Presidential Rank Award is bestowed each year by the President upon a small group of career employees and is the nation’s highest civil service award. “I am very proud of these outstanding men and women and am grateful for their dedication to the DHS mission,” said Secretary of Homeland Security Jeh C. Johnson. “These demonstrated leaders inspire their colleagues and bring great passion and innovation to public service in support of homeland security.” This prestigious honor is divided into two categories: Distinguished rank for leaders who achieve sustained extraordinary results, and Meritorious rank for leaders with sustained accomplishments.
